E396 NRL is a 1987 Porsche 944 in Blue with a 2,479c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 20 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 65%.
Across all 1987 Porsche 944 models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.2% with a typical mileage of 123,544 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Porsche 944 f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 4,364 recorded failures. If you're considering buying E396 NRL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Porsche 944 typically stays on UK roads for around 44 years. At 39 years old, this Porsche 944 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
